Dwarf forsythia. Graceful arching branches on a compact shrub. Blooms profusely in early spring with showy, yellow flowers. Foliage is fresh green. Easy to grow and very tolerant.
Botanical Name- Forsythia x 'Courtasol'
Pronunciation- for-SITH-ee-uh ex
Foliage- Deciduous
Mature Width- 6 ft
Mature Height- 3 ft
Sun Exposure- Full Sun
Soil Preferences- Tolerant of most soils, except extremely wet
Current Size- #3
Bloom Color- Yellow
Bloom Time- Early spring
Companion Plants- Phlox subulata 'Emerald Pink' (early spring color, creeping form)
Fauna Attracted- Early-season bees (bumble, honey), hoverflies
Plant Habit- Shrub
- Care Rating- Easy

Yearly Care Instructions- Prune right after flowering; fertilize in spring and water during dry periods.
Trimming Instructions- Prune immediately after flowering to shape and encourage blooms.
Fertilization Instructions- Use a balanced fertilizer (e.g., 14-14-14) right after flowering in spring; moderate feeding need. Loosen clay soil around roots to improve drainage.
Fertilizer Recommendation- Plant-tone
Possible Issues- Crown gall, aphids
